软骨发育不全的磁共振静脉血管造影:颈静脉孔处静脉狭窄与脑积水的相关性。

Magnetic resonance venography of achondroplasia: correlation of venous narrowing at the jugular foramen with hydrocephalus.

作者信息

Moritani Toshio, Aihara Toshinori, Oguma Eiji, Makiyama Yasuhide, Nishimoto Hiroshi, Smoker Wendy R K, Sato Yutaka

机构信息

Department of Radiology, Saitama Children's Medical Center, 2100 Magome, Iwatsuki, Saitama 339, Japan.

出版信息

Clin Imaging. 2006 May-Jun;30(3):195-200. doi: 10.1016/j.clinimag.2005.10.004.

DOI:10.1016/j.clinimag.2005.10.004
PMID:16632156
Abstract

In achondroplasia, venous narrowing associated with a small skull base leads to elevated venous pressure which impairs cerebrospinal fluid (CSF) absorption, resulting in communicating hydrocephalus. We correlated venous narrowing at the jugular foramina and collateral circulation on magnetic resonance venography (MRV) with ventricular size in 17 patients. Patients were divided into three groups: Group I: progressive hydrocephalus; Group II: nonprogressive hydrocephalus; and Group III: normal ventricular size. The grades of venous narrowing and types of collaterals were well correlated with hydrocephalus groups.

摘要

在软骨发育不全中,与小颅底相关的静脉狭窄导致静脉压升高,这会损害脑脊液(CSF)的吸收,从而导致交通性脑积水。我们对17例患者磁共振静脉血管造影(MRV)上颈静脉孔处的静脉狭窄及侧支循环与脑室大小进行了相关性分析。患者被分为三组:第一组:进行性脑积水;第二组:非进行性脑积水;第三组:脑室大小正常。静脉狭窄程度和侧支类型与脑积水组显著相关。
